Suburban teen pleads guilty in threats case

CHICAGO William Kuhns, 18, is a former student at the school. In court Friday, he admitted he made statements on his MySpace Internet page last year about killing students and teachers.

Kuhns pleaded guilty to a disorderly conduct charge. He is required to pay a $200 fine and to do 100 hours of community service.

Prosecutors say there is no indication Kuhns really was serious about following through on those threats.
